A Foundation for Success: Career Readiness Session Launched Ahead of ITUM Career Fair 2025

The Institute of Technology, University of Moratuwa (ITUM) successfully launched a high-impact Special Session on Career Readiness on August 21st, 2025, marking the first major preparatory event leading up to the ITUM Career Fair 2025. Held at the Multifunctional Hall with an enthusiastic audience of over 500 students and staff, the session served as a vital platform to prepare diplomates for the expectations of the professional world.

Strategic Purpose and Organization

The primary objective of the session was to equip students for their upcoming industrial internships and to instill a strong, forward-looking professional mindset as they transition into real-world work environments.

The program was organized by the Industrial Training, Career Guidance, and Post Diploma Education Centre, following an invitation and overall coordination by Dr. Ruchira Wijesena, Head of the Centre. The initiative was executed by the Training Unit, including the dedicated contribution of Eng. Kamalnath Jinadasa, Training Engineer, whose operational support ensured smooth delivery and wide participation.

The large turnout reflects the Centre’s growing capacity to design and deliver meaningful, high-impact professional development experiences for ITUM students.

Insights from a Global Leader

The keynote speaker was Dr. Ranil Sugathadasa, an internationally respected leadership coach known for empowering millions worldwide. His inspiring session, Unlock Your Future, emphasized the pivotal role of mindset, resilience, emotional intelligence, and personal leadership in navigating the modern career landscape.

While recognizing the value of technical expertise, Dr. Sugathadasa highlighted that true professional success requires a proactive, growth-oriented attitude capable of adapting to challenges and opportunities.

Interactive and Transformative Engagement

Structured as a highly interactive one-hour dialogue, the session encouraged students to reflect deeply on their aspirations and strengths. Real-world examples, practical insights, and direct student engagement made the session both relatable and motivating.

The core message embracing a winning, future-ready attitude—resonated strongly with participants and supported ITUM’s broader mission of nurturing both technical proficiency and professional excellence.
